Transaction ae233ff16c7bb672de530934b311808c1db22518486693e956007dc8b3e29a54
2 Input
2 Outputs
- ae233ff16c7bb672de530934b311808c1db22518486693e956007dc8b3e29a54:0
- ae233ff16c7bb672de530934b311808c1db22518486693e956007dc8b3e29a54:1
value 26539
address 13d6zsAncgnieM3u4ZwBdMakSZS2dMpCZC
value 73699
address 3DZarjNwTZvmP3AeaBmm7Uk8bXQTMniFUV